I have encountered this repeatedly and just come in another way. When you get service unavailable message click on “index” in top right corner (3/4 horizontal lines). From there click on My Porsche and then Overview-should bring you in to working menu. Good luck.

Originally Posted by GuardsRed992
I'm in Canada so it seems as if the Porsche online tracker isn't as detailed as the US one. I saw on the site I now have my VIN. Does that mean my car is finished construction? Thanks
No , unfortunately at all ! It could be , but having serial number does not mean anything.

As an example, this serial number came in, mid April. Since then , the production has been pushed to May, June, and now July ( hopefully). But of course it could be pushed again...
